Referral Programs

The Nassau County Health Department is also responsible for providing coordination for the County Medical Indigent Program (CMIP) and Health Care Reimbursement Act (HCRA) for Nassau County. The purpose of the CMIP Program is to provide financial assistance to eligible Nassau County Residents needing specialty physician services. The HCRA Program is designed to assist with financial reimbursement for services provided by health care facilities (hospitals) to individuals deemed financially indigent. The HCRA reimburses health care facilities out of Nassau County who are able to provide services in an emergency or life-threatening situation.
